Defining Gel HPMC: A Simple Explanation

In simple terms, gel HPMC is a form of a cellulose derivative that swells upon contact with water, forming a viscous, transparent gel. Made by chemically modifying cellulose from plant fibers, it acts as a thickener, binder, emulsifier, or film former depending on its formulation and use. Think of it like nature’s answer to flexible, water-retentive glue that also plays nice with many materials.

Its use spans from thickening toothpaste to enhancing cement mixes, and even as a carrier in controlled-release medications. The beauty lies in its biodegradability combined with its functional versatility, making it indispensable for industries aiming to blend performance with ecological mindfulness.

Core Features of Gel HPMC That Make It Tick

1. Controlled Viscosity and Gelation

The defining characteristic of gel HPMC is its ability to form gels with predictable viscosity at certain temperatures. This thermal gelation means it can transition from liquid to gel smoothly, perfect for applications where consistency and flow matter — like plastering or when designing slow-release drug capsules.

2. Water Retention and Stability

It’s fascinating how gel HPMC helps construction materials retain water longer, improving curing times and overall strength. This also comes handy in cosmetics where moisture retention boosts skin hydration.

3. Compatibility with Diverse Materials

Whether mixed into cement, paint, pharmaceuticals, or food products, gel HPMC plays well with others. This trait is critical because it ensures broad adoption without altering base formulas drastically.

4. Non-Toxic and Biodegradable

Increasingly important in a world longing for green chemistry, gel HPMC is environmentally friendly. It breaks down naturally and poses no toxicity risks, which aligns with global sustainability goals.

5. Ease of Processing and Customization

Manufacturers can tweak the molecular weight and degree of substitution to create gels tailored for specific textures or release profiles.

Practical Uses of Gel HPMC Around the World

Oddly enough, while many of us never think about it, gel HPMC quietly shapes various industries:

  • Construction: Used as a water-retaining agent and binder in plasters and mortars to improve durability especially in hot or dry climates (think Middle East or North Africa).
  • Pharmaceuticals: In controlled-release tablets and topical gels, it ensures medicines release steadily and predictably.
  • Food Industry: Acts as a thickener and stabilizer in gluten-free products, helping texture and shelf life.
  • Cosmetics: Adds moisture-holding benefits to creams and lotions.
  • Disaster Relief: In temporary shelter coatings and quick-setting mortars, gel HPMC contributes to faster, safer builds during emergencies.

Table: Typical Product Specifications for Gel HPMC

Property Typical Value Unit
Viscosity (2% solution at 20°C) 2500 - 4000 mPa·s
pH (1% solution) 5.5 - 8.0 -
Degree of Substitution (Methoxy) 19 - 24 %
Thermal Gelation Temperature 65 - 75 °C
